AI Summary

  • Creates a non-refundable tax credit for food businesses (farms, restaurants, food stores) that donate food, meals, or crops to nonprofit food distribution organizations, equal to the fair market value of donations up to $25,000 annually

  • Provides civil liability protection for food donors (farms, restaurants, food stores, individuals) who donate food to nonprofits or directly to individuals for consumption, including food past its open date

  • Extends liability protection to nonprofit organizations and food stores that distribute donated food free or at cost, provided they comply with state and local health department inspection and permit requirements

  • Eliminates license requirements for food prepared in private homes when donated to nonprofits for free distribution, and waives permit fees for food distribution under this program

  • Excludes alcoholic beverages, marijuana products, and dietary supplements from liability protection, and removes protection for misbranded/adulterated food or injuries caused by gross negligence, recklessness, or intentional misconduct
